746 THE MOVING PICTURE WORLD May 1. 1920 (PsunU PtBdlnf ) Price of Machine, Complete $16.50 inclnding ten sticks of eomponnd Price per Box of Ten SHcka $IM In Lots of Ten Boxes $.7S i box A SMALL INVESTMENTLARGE RETURNS— This Machine is designed to apply a wax compound to the margin of New Films, to prevent damage during the first few runs thru the Projecting Machine. The collecting of emulsion from "green" films on aperture plate and tension springs of the projector is in many cases causing untold damage to the film and excessive wear to the projector as well as marring the presentation on the screen by jumping. Proper Waxing of New Films — Prolongs the life of the Film. Eliminates excessive wear on Projecting Machine. Insures Steady Pictures on the screen. Prevents tearing of sprocket holes by emulsion deposits. AND Saves the film from having Oil squirted all over it by some Operator trytac to get "green" film thru his machine without a stop. The Werner Film Waxing Machine applies the Compound accurately to the margin of the film and positively will not spread wax onto the picture. Wax always in position. Requires no adjusting.
